But where? Far to the north of the North Metro. Approximately a 3 1/2 hour, 230 mile drive north. Past Duluth, Minnesota and the North Shore of Lake Superior, somewhere between Silver Bay and Isabella Minnesota at an undisclosed lake in a County, far far away. Jack Frost really was nipping on my nose. We did have a nice little fire on shore, but we didn't have chestnuts to roast. However, we did have trail mix, and some beer. Good enough! There was no singing...except for that catchy tune by Homer Simpson, "Spiderpig, spiderpig. Spiderpig does whatever a spiderpig does". No, not quite the Christmasy Carols you probably think we should have been singing. But, we are not Dean Martin, Nat King Cole, nor Frank Sinatra. We leave the singing to the those with more melodic voices. I must say, we were dressed like Eskimos. It was fairly cold out there; just look at the handywork of Jack Frost on those trees. And the lake. We were standing out on the lake, standing on 6 inches of snow on top of 4 inches of ice over 10 feet of water. Without Jack Frost, our ice fishing trip would never have happened. Oh yes, Jack Frost was here! We even managed to catch two small walleyes...must have been too cold even for the fish!
